Residential fire restoration services involve a comprehensive process to repair and restore homes affected by fire damage. When a fire occurs, it can leave behind not only visible burns but also smoke residue, soot accumulation, and structural damage that may not be immediately apparent. Fire restoration professionals assess the extent of the damage, remove debris, and clean surfaces to eliminate smoke odors and residue. They also work to repair or replace damaged building materials, ensuring the home is safe and livable once again. This process helps homeowners recover from the chaos of a fire and restore their property to its pre-loss condition.

These services are essential for addressing a variety of problems caused by fires. Smoke and soot can permeate walls, ceilings, and furnishings, leaving behind persistent odors and staining that are difficult to remove without specialized equipment. Structural components like framing, drywall, and flooring may be compromised, requiring careful inspection and replacement. Additionally, water used to extinguish the fire can lead to water damage, mold growth, and compromised insulation. Fire restoration professionals help solve these issues by thoroughly cleaning, disinfecting, and repairing affected areas, reducing the risk of further damage or health hazards.

The overview below groups typical Residential Fire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Owings Mills,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fire damage repairs, such as soot cleanup or small area restorations,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ials involved.

Moderate Restoration - Medium-scale projects like partial rebuilding or extensive cleaning can cost between $1,000-$3,500. These jobs are common for homes with significant smoke or fire damage requiring more detailed work.

Major Reconstruction - Larger, more complex projects such as full room rebuilds or extensive structural repairs often fall in the $4,000-$10,000 range.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ving extensive damage or older properties needing comprehensive restoration.

Full Home Restoration - Complete fire restoration for an entire residence can range from $15,000 to $50,000 or more, depending on size and severity. Such extensive projects are less frequent but necessary for severe fire events requiring comprehensive rebuilding and rep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
